Sanwei TR-3 is a 5-ply all-wood blade crafted for developing players seeking a balanced and forgiving platform. It emphasizes exceptional control and a soft, communicative feel, making it ideal for beginners and club players focused on refining technique. The blade offers moderate speed, providing enough power for offensive development while prioritizing consistency and ball feedback. Its traditional construction delivers a reliable, all-round performance perfect for building a solid foundation in table tennis.

5-Ply Construction

The blade features a straightforward 5-ply all-wood construction. This traditional design emphasizes natural wood properties to provide a soft feel, good dwell time, and excellent player feedback, making it consistent and ideal for developing all-round styles.

Speed
6.5

Sanwei TR-3 offers a moderate, all-round speed. It's not built for extreme pace but provides enough power for developing offensive shots and counter-attacks. The design prioritizes control and feel, making it well-suited for players who focus on precise placement and spin generation over raw hitting power.

Control
8.8

Control is where the TR-3 truly shines. Its softer feel and generous dwell time let players manage the ball with ease, place shots accurately, and generate consistent spin. This high level of control makes it an excellent tool for beginners mastering fundamentals and for all-round players who rely on precision and tactical consistency.

Feel
Medium-Soft
SoftMedium-SoftHard

Sanwei TR-3 delivers a soft to medium-soft feel, thanks to its all-wood build. This provides excellent ball feedback, allowing players to distinctly feel contact, which aids immensely in developing touch, control, and spin sensitivity.

Throw Angle
Medium-High
LowMedium-HighHigh

Sanwei TR-3 likely produces a medium-high throw angle. This characteristic makes it easier to loop and lift the ball, especially against backspin, aiding players who are still perfecting their stroke mechanics.

Dwell Time
8.0

The 5-ply all-wood construction grants a long dwell time. This extended contact helps players impart more spin and feel the ball securely on the racket, which is particularly beneficial for developing looping techniques and delicate touch shots.

Flexibility
6.0

The all-wood build gives the TR-3 a medium level of flexibility. This creates a good balance, allowing players to feel the blade flex during powerful strokes, which aids in both spin generation and controlled placement.

Vibration
6.0

The blade provides a medium level of vibration. It offers enough feedback for a player to sense ball contact without being overly jarring, thanks to good shock absorption that reduces unnecessary harshness.

Quality
7.5

For its price point, the TR-3 offers very good build quality. It's a durable 5-ply wood blade that holds up well to regular training and club use. While it doesn't have the premium finish of high-end models, its construction is reliable and represents strong value, meeting expectations for a budget-friendly, entry to intermediate blade.
